In a groundbreaking collaboration, the United States and the United Arab Emirates have embarked on an ambitious project to construct a massive AI data center campus in Abu Dhabi, powered by an impressive capacity of 5GW. This initiative marks a significant milestone in technological advancement and sets the stage for profound shifts in global tech dynamics. The collaboration, involving prominent US hyperscalers and the Emirati AI firm G42, showcases the commitment of both nations to pushing the boundaries of artificial intelligence. Spearheaded by Tahnoun bin Zayed Al Nahyan, the project is set to revolutionize the landscape of AI and cloud services by harnessing an array of energy sources, including nuclear, solar, and gas. This strategic move underscores the UAE’s ambition to be at the forefront of technological innovation, while simultaneously reinforcing its stature as a leader in the AI domain. As plans unfold, the implications of this venture extend far beyond the immediate partnership, potentially redefining connectivity and data management for nearly half of the global populace.

The US Secretary of Commerce, Howard Lutnick, has emphasized the agreement’s significance in promoting investment in the two countries’ advanced semiconductor and data center industries. This focus on advanced technology investment underscores a commitment to ensuring stringent security measures. These measures aim to prevent any potential technology diversion, thereby reinforcing the strategic foundation of this collaboration. As global cities compete for latency-sensitive services, especially in AI-driven endeavors, the project seeks a competitive edge by offering latency-friendly services to a substantial portion of the world’s population.

In terms of geopolitical dynamics, the evolving relationship between the US, UAE, and China has further accentuated the project’s significance. Historically, ties with China had encompassed technology-sharing agreements, but under pressure from the Biden administration, these connections have been severed. Consequently, the decision to lift chip export limits, initially instituted by the Trump administration to restrict technology flow to China, signifies a significant strategic pivot. This key decision underlines both nations’ commitment to fostering a controlled and secure technological corridor, ensuring that the benefits of AI development are exclusively directed towards bolstering their positions on the global technology stage. The withdrawal from Chinese technology collaborations shifts the focus towards enhancing American and Emirati investments, allowing for a more synergistic and mutually beneficial alliance in AI exploration and implementation.
